Output 7558a3c0677882d645e7c95341a7e23b004186b9e430999ddbda01d8b09dbf31:0

value
31200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3698bc2b1f4c160fbc1b5a0c311026e3358cc86 OP_EQUAL
address
3Pt4ZcrYBU5H8K8XeciXqcxpGtcvmX8trm
transaction
7558a3c0677882d645e7c95341a7e23b004186b9e430999ddbda01d8b09dbf31
spent
true